    Labkotec GA-1 Grease Separator Alarm Device

    Labkotec-GA-1-Grease-Separator-Alarm-product

    General Information

    GA-1 is an alarm device for monitoring the thickness of the grease layer accumulating in a grease separator. The system consists of a GA-1 control unit, a GA-SG1 sensor, and a cable joint. Labkotec-GA-1-Grease-Separator-Alarm-figure-1

    Grease separator supervision with the GA-1 alarm device

    GA-SG1 sensor is installed in the grease separator, and it supervises the thickness of the grease layer. The LED indicators, push button, and interfaces of the GA-1 control unit are described in Figure 2.Labkotec-GA-1-Grease-Separator-Alarm-figure-2

    Installation

    GA-1 control unit

    GA-1 control unit can be wall-mounted. The mounting holes are located in the base plate of the enclosure, beneath the mounting holes of the front cover. The cover of the enclosure must be tightened so that the edges touch the base frame.

    GA-SG1 sensor

    GA-SG1 sensor should be installed as described in Figure 3. The sensor gives an alarm latest when it is wholly immersed in grease. Please check the correct installation depth also from the instructions of the grease separator.

    Accessories

    The delivery includes a cable joint (figure 4), fixing accessories (figure 5) for installation of the control unit and the sensor. Connections of the sensor cable inside the cable joint are explained in Figure 3. If shielded cable is used cable shields and possible excess wires need to be connected to the same point in galvanic contact. IP rating of the cable joint is IP68. Make sure that the cable joint is closed properly.

    Operation

    The operation of the alarm device should always be checked after the installation. Also, check the operation always when emptying the separator or at least once every six months.

    Functionality test

    1. Immerse the sensorino in water. The device should be in normal mode.
    2. Lift the sensor in the air or grease it. A grease alarm should be generated (see chapter 3.1 for a more detailed description).
    3. Clean up the sensor.
    4. Immerse the sensor back into water. The alarm should go off after a delay of 10 seconds.

    A more detailed description of the operation is provided in Chapter 3.1. If the operation is not as described here, check connections and cabling. If necessary, contact a representative of the manufacturer.

    Modes of Operation
    • Normal mode – no alarms. The main LED indicator is on. Other LED indicators are off.
    • The main LED indicator is on. The Grease Alarm LED indicator is on. Buzzer on after 10 10-second delay. Relay de-energize after 10 sec delay.
    • Fault alarm: Sensor cable break, short circuit, or a broken sensor. The main LED indicator is on. Sensor circuit, Fault LED indicator is on after a 1010-second delay. The buzzer is on after 10 10-second delay. The relay de-energizes after 10 10-second delay.
    • Reset the alarm when pressing the Reset/Test push button.
      The buzzer will go off.

    Function

    Attention! Before pressing the Reset/Test button, make sure that the change of relay status does not cause hazards elsewhere!

    • Normal situation. When pressing the Reset/Test push button, the Grease Alarm and Fault LED indicators are immediately on. The buzzerr is immediately on.
    • Relay de-energize after 2 seconds of continuous pressing. Relay energize immediately.
    • Alarm on. When pressing the Reset/Test push button for the first time, the Buzzer will go off. When pressing the Reset/Test push button after that, the Fault LED indicator is immediately on. Grease Alarm LED indicator remains on. Buzzer remains on.
    • Fault alarm on. When pressing the Reset/Test push button, the device does not react to the test at all.

    Technical Data

    GA-1
    GA-1 control unit
    Dimensions125 mm x 75 mm x 35 mm (L x H x D)
    Weight250 g

    Package 0,8 kg (control unit + sensor + cable joint)

    EnclosureIP 65, material polycarbonate
    Cable bushings3 pcs M16 for cable diameter 5-10 mm
    Operating environmentTemperature: -30 ºC…+50 ºC
    Max. elevation above sea level 2,000 m
    Relative humidity RH 100%
    Suitable for indoor and outdoor use (protected from direct rain)
    Supply voltage230 VAC ± 10 %, 50/60 Hz
    Fuse maximum 10 A.
    Power consumption5 VA
    SensorsGA-SG1 sensor
    Relay outputPotential-free relay output
    250 V, 5 A|
    Operational delay 10 sec. Relay de-energize at the trigger point.
    Electrical safetyEN IEC 61010-1, Class II, CAT II, POLLUTION DEGREE 2
    EMC Emission ImmunityEN IEC 61000-6-3
    EN IEC 61000-6-1
    Manufacturing year: Please see the serial number on the type platexxx x xxxxx xx YY x
    where YY = manufacturing year (e.g. 19 = 2019)
    GA-SG1
    GA-SG1 sensor
    Principle of operationCapacitive
    MaterialPOM, chlorinated polyethylene rubber (CM), AISI 316
    Weight350 g (sensor + fixed cable)
    IP-classificationIP68
    Operation temperature0 ºC…+90 ºC
    CableFixed cable 2 x 0.75 mm² Ø 5,8mm. Standard length 5 m, other lengths optional. The max. Maximum cable loop resistance is 75 Ω.
    EMC Emission ImmunityEN IEC 61000-6-3
    EN IEC 61000-6-1
    Manufacturing year: Please see the serial number from the bottom of the sensorGAxxxxxYY
    where YY = manufacturing year (e.g. 19 = 2019)

    Troubleshooting

    • Problem: No alarm when the sensor is in grease or air, or the alarm will not go off
    • Possible reason: Sensor is dirty.
    • To do: Clean up the sensor and check the operation again.
    • Problem: MAINS LED indicator is off
    • Possible reason: The Device doesn’t get the supply voltage.
    • To do: Measure the voltage between poles N and L1. It should be 230 VAC ± 10 %.
    • Problem: FAULT LED indicator is on
    • Possible reason: Current in the sensor circuit too low (cable break or out of the connector) or too high (cable in short circuit).
    • To do:
      1. Measure the voltage separately between the poles 7 and 8. The voltages should be between 7,0 – 8,5 V.
      2. Measure sensor current when the sensor is in the air or in grease. The measured current should be 7,0 – 8,5 mA. Measure the current when Labkotec GA-1 Grease Separator Alarm Device the sensor is in the water. Measured current should be 2,5 – 3,5 mA.

    Repair & Service

    The easiest way to check the operation is to lift the Labkotec GA-1 Grease Separator Alarm Device sensor out of the separator and then put it back in. In case of queries, please get in touch with Labkotec Oy’s service.
